Software Systems Engineer develops, modifies and codes software systems programming applications. Responsible for resolving less complicated problems relying on the established software systems. Being a Software Systems Engineer has basic knowledge of the principles of existing software systems development. Troubleshoots and fixes minor problems regarding current procedures or systems. Additionally, Software Systems Engineer requ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or. To be a Software Systems Engineer typically requires 0-2 years of related experience.
